excel怎么除以多个

excel怎么除以多个

一、 使用公式、借助辅助列、批量操作是将Excel中的单元格除以多个数值的常见方法。使用公式是最为常见和灵活的方法,通过公式可以灵活地进行各种计算,避免人工操作的繁琐。下面将详细介绍如何在Excel中使用公式、借助辅助列、批量操作来实现除以多个数值的功能。

使用公式

在Excel中,公式可以让我们进行各种复杂的计算。假设我们有一列数据A,我们希望将这些数据分别除以两个数值5和10。我们可以在另一个列B中输入公式来完成这个操作。

  1. 单个公式操作:在B1单元格中输入公式 =A1/5,然后向下拖动填充柄,复制公式到其他单元格。类似地,可以在C1单元格中输入 =A1/10,并向下拖动填充柄。

  2. 混合公式操作:如果希望在同一个单元格内进行多个除法操作,可以使用组合公式。例如,在B1中输入 =A1/5 & " , " & A1/10,这样每个单元格将显示两个除法结果,用逗号隔开。

  3. 使用数组公式:如果希望一次性对整个范围进行操作,可以使用数组公式。选择一个范围,例如B1:B10,输入 =A1:A10 / {5,10},然后按 Ctrl+Shift+Enter,Excel会将其转换为数组公式。

借助辅助列

有时候我们可能需要借助辅助列来实现除以多个数值的操作。这种方法适用于需要进行较复杂计算或希望将结果保存在不同列中的情况。

  1. 创建辅助列:假设我们有一列数据A,我们希望将这些数据分别除以数值5和10。我们可以创建两个辅助列B和C,在B列中输入公式 =A1/5,在C列中输入公式 =A1/10

  2. 批量操作:如果数据量较大,我们可以利用Excel的自动填充功能,快速将公式应用到整个辅助列。选择B1单元格,双击右下角的填充柄,Excel会自动填充整个列。同样操作C列。

  3. 合并结果:如果希望将结果合并到一个单元格中,可以在D列中输入公式 =B1 & " , " & C1,这样每个单元格将显示两个除法结果,用逗号隔开。

批量操作

Excel提供了多种批量操作方法,可以帮助我们快速完成大量数据的计算。

  1. 使用VBA宏:如果需要进行大量复杂的计算,可以考虑使用VBA宏。编写一个简单的宏,循环遍历数据区域,将每个单元格除以多个数值,并将结果存储在指定位置。

Sub BatchDivision()

Dim rng As Range

Dim cell As Range

Dim i As Integer

Set rng = Range("A1:A10")

i = 1

For Each cell In rng

Cells(i, 2).Value = cell.Value / 5

Cells(i, 3).Value = cell.Value / 10

i = i + 1

Next cell

End Sub

  1. 使用Power Query:如果数据量非常大,可以考虑使用Power Query。导入数据后,在Power Query编辑器中添加自定义列,编写自定义函数进行除法操作,然后将结果加载回Excel。

结论

在Excel中进行多个除法操作有多种方法,具体选择哪种方法取决于数据量、计算复杂度以及个人习惯。使用公式是最为灵活和常见的方法,适合各种场景;借助辅助列可以帮助我们更清晰地管理和查看计算结果;批量操作适用于数据量较大或需要进行复杂计算的情况。通过合理选择和组合这些方法,可以高效地完成数据处理任务,提高工作效率。

相关问答FAQs:

1. 如何在Excel中进行多个数值的除法运算?

在Excel中进行多个数值的除法运算,可以使用公式来实现。首先,选中想要放置结果的单元格,然后输入等式。例如,如果要将A1、B1和C1三个单元格的数值相除,可以输入以下公式:

=A1/B1/C1

按下Enter键后,Excel将自动计算并显示结果。

2. 如何在Excel中将一个数值除以多个数值?

如果你想要将一个数值除以多个数值,在Excel中也可以通过公式来实现。例如,假设你想要将数值10除以A1、B1和C1三个单元格的数值,可以使用以下公式:

=10/A1/B1/C1

按下Enter键后,Excel将计算并显示结果。

3. 如何在Excel中进行多个单元格数值的除法运算?

如果你想要在Excel中进行多个单元格数值的除法运算,可以使用SUM函数结合除法运算符来实现。例如,假设你想要将A1、A2和A3三个单元格的数值相加后再除以B1的数值,可以使用以下公式:

=SUM(A1:A3)/B1

按下Enter键后,Excel将计算并显示结果。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/5025630

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部